061: Desmond's and Black representation on TV

This week's episode will explore the Black sitcom: Desmond's. A 6 series comedy, set in a Guyanese barbershop in Peckham. We'll look at:1)Why it started?2) How important it was in challenging negative stereotypical portrayals of Black people at the time?3) How important is the show for viewers today?4) Some political commentary in the show.5) The Cast: Where are they now?
